Although Dallas won Game 1 on the road, the splits between starter Daniel Gafford and reserve Dereck Lively II continue to be eye-opening. After Lively II led the Mavs in plus-minus during the Conference Semifinals at +71, with Gafford a team-worse -58, Lively outpaced Gafford in that stat by a +19 to -15 count in Game 1. The two continue to roughly split minutes at center, although Lively has slowly worked his way to a workload edge despite coming off the bench, averaging 26.3 minutes per game over Dallas' last five compared to 21.3 for Gafford.

McDaniels' shooting emergence has been one of the biggest developments for the Timberwolves. He led Minnesota in scoring during Game 1 with 24 points on 15 shots, including a 6-9 mark from three. After starting the postseason 5-of-23 from beyond the arc (21.7%), he's made 12 of his last 18 (66.7%).
